How Resin Rock Handles Utah Weather
Utah’s weather can be unpredictable—from intense summer heat to snowy, freezing winters. These extreme shifts in temperature and moisture can wear down traditional surfaces like plain concrete or pavers. That’s where Resin Rock overlay comes in.
Known for both its beauty and strength, Resin Rock is built to handle tough conditions—including the weather challenges we face here in Utah. If you're considering this surface option for your driveway, patio, pool deck, or walkway, here’s why it's a smart, weather-resistant choice.
Tough Against Temperature Changes
Utah experiences a wide range of temperatures throughout the year. In winter, surfaces expand and contract as temperatures drop below freezing and rise again during the day. This constant shift can lead to cracking, chipping, and surface damage—especially on untreated concrete.
Resin Rock is flexible and resilient. The stone-and-resin blend is designed to withstand freeze-thaw cycles, preventing cracking and separating even when the weather changes quickly. That makes it perfect for places like Utah where temperature swings are common.
UV-Resistant for Hot Summers
Utah’s summers are not only hot—they’re also sunny. Prolonged sun exposure can cause certain surfaces to fade, discolor, or become brittle over time.
Resin Rock is made with UV-stable resins that resist fading and discoloration, even under direct sunlight. This helps maintain its vibrant color and clean look all year long, without the surface becoming dull or damaged by heat.
Non-Slip When Wet or Icy
Snow, ice, and rain are all part of life in Utah. A surface that becomes slippery when wet is a safety hazard, especially around pools, entryways, or driveways.
The textured finish of Resin Rock is naturally slip-resistant, offering better traction even when the surface is wet or frosty. This makes it a safer choice for homeowners, kids, and guests year-round.
Drains Water Effectively
Another way Resin Rock handles Utah weather is through its ability to drain water quickly. The small gaps between the stones allow water to run off the surface rather than pool or collect. This helps reduce the chance of standing water, ice buildup, or erosion—problems that can damage traditional concrete over time.
